The thought of another salad did not sound the least bit appealing. I looked up recipes and found one that i could modify to what i had available. It was called Chinese Apricot Stir Fry I stir fried a bag of frozen sugar snap peas, carrots, mushrooms, and onions. I added 1 TB of 4 berry preserve(unsweetened) 1TB red cooking wine, a dash of coconut aminos, slivered almonds, sesame seeds and some Mrs Dash. It actually was really good.
